Instructions

    • 1

      Stretch and expand your arms out to either side. Consciously draw pure love, positive energy and life-affirming goodness into your arms.

    • 2

      Inhale and smile.

    • 3

      As you exhale, wrap your arms around your body. Imagine that you are delivering all that goodness, positive energy and love straight to your heart.

    • 4

      Embrace like you mean it. Squeeze yourself the way you would if you were hugging a loved one. Drop your head, rub your shoulders, relax, hold on and breathe.

    • 5

      Sweet talk. Say, "I cherish you self. You are a wonderful, worthy, beautiful self. I am truly grateful for you. All is well. Rest assured and know that you are loved. I love you."

    • 6

      Release your arms. Allow the feeling of being cared for and adored to stay with you throughout the day.

    • 7

      Repeat three times a day, but try not to fall too much in love!
